Removal Of Cyclohexane From A Contaminated Air Stream Using A Dense Phase Membrane Bioreactor, Michael G. Roberts
Theses and Dissertations
The purpose of this research was to determine the ability of a dense phase membrane bioreactor to remove cyclohexane, a volatile organic compound in JP-8 jet fuel, from a contaminated air stream using a biologically active film for degradation. The research answered questions regarding applications of membrane bioreactors, the ability of cyclohexane to diffuse through a dense phase membrane, growth of a viable microbial culture, and determination of the performance capabilities of the reactor.
